Make it Myself at The Resource Exchange w/Ants on a Log & Jeanette Bradley
March 18, 2023 @ 2:00 pm - 4:00 pm
“Make it Myself” March musical performance, eco-creative reuse workshop and book reading event for Children (& Other Childlike People!)
What is Make It Myself March?
A month-long creative reuse celebration for kids & families, including a special, interactive “Make it Myself” musical performance, workshop and book reading event on Saturday, March 18th with:
• Special musical performance by Philly’s favorite family-friendly band Ants on a Log, in celebration of their new album “Make it Myself”!
• Creative Reuse Maker Space at The Resource Exchange, where children & other child-like people & their adults can create art to display in a “Make it Myself” exhibit through Earth Day!
• Paint a special traveling art delivery box for The Rounds e-bike deliveries, to be seen all over the city!!
• Book reading by Jeanette Bradley , author of “Something Great” and “No World Too Big”! You can pre-order these beautifully written & illustrated books to be waiting for you at the event and signed by the author! Pre-order below from the wonderful local bookstore The Head & The Hand Books!
Where is it? The Resource Exchange 1800 N American St in Kensington
When is it? Saturday, March 18th – “Make it Myself” workshop & performance 2-4 pm
Who is it for? Children (& Other Childlike People!) Recommended for ages 5-12
